Backflow service involves inspecting, testing, and maintaining backflow prevention devices to ensure that potable water supplies remain uncontaminated. These devices are installed in plumbing systems to prevent contaminated water from flowing back into the clean water supply, especially in cases where pressure changes or system failures occur. Professionals specializing in backflow services can evaluate existing devices, perform necessary testing to verify their proper operation, and carry out repairs or replacements when issues are identified. Regular maintenance and testing are essential to ensure these devices function correctly and to comply with local health and safety regulations.
This service helps address problems related to backflow incidents, which can pose serious health risks by allowing pollutants, bacteria, or chemicals to enter drinking water supplies. Common causes of backflow include pressure fluctuations in the water system, cross-connections between potable and non-potable water sources, or aging and faulty backflow prevention devices. By ensuring these devices are functioning properly, backflow services help prevent water contamination, protect public health, and avoid costly property damage or water service interruptions caused by backflow events.
Properties that typically utilize backflow services include residential homes, commercial buildings, industrial facilities, and institutions such as schools or hospitals. Residential properties often require testing of their backflow preventers to maintain safe drinking water, especially if they have irrigation systems or other cross-connections. Commercial and industrial properties may have more complex plumbing systems with multiple backflow prevention devices, necessitating regular inspections to ensure compliance with local regulations. These services are also important for properties with fire sprinkler systems, process water systems, or other specialized plumbing configurations that could pose contamination risks.

Inspection Costs - Backflow service inspections typically range from $100 to $300, depending on the complexity of the system. For example, a basic inspection in Hartville might cost around $150. Additional fees may apply for extensive testing or reports.
Repair Expenses - Repair costs for backflow devices generally fall between $200 and $600. Minor repairs, such as replacing a valve, might be closer to $200, while more extensive repairs could reach $600 or more. Service providers will assess the specific issue to provide an accurate estimate.
Replacement Prices - Replacing a backflow preventer usually costs between $500 and $1,500. The price varies based on the type and size of the device, with more complex or larger units costing toward the higher end of the range. Installation fees are often included in the total estimate.
Service Call Fees - Many service providers charge a service call fee ranging from $50 to $150 for backflow-related work. This fee covers the technician’s assessment and travel expenses before any repairs or replacements are performed. Contact local pros for specific pricing details.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
